## Deploying the Gatewick Proctor Queue

Deploys are pretty painless: push to main, wait for the pipeline, then watch the queue drain dashboard for five minutes. If candidates pile up mid-exam, roll back first and ask questions later — the queue replays safely. Everything the workers care about lives in one config block, shown here for reference.

settings of bafof-yagef:
JOROX_PIN=8740
JOROX_TENANT=pelox
JOROX_METRICS_HOST=metrics.jorox.qorvelworks.internal
JOROX_SEAL=seal_c78f63c1
JOROX_STANDBY_TEAM=norax

This PR reworks Gridloom's fill heuristic: we now weight word frequency against crossing difficulty, and abandon branches earlier when the letter-distribution score drops. Please check the backtrack bound carefully — it interacts with grid size nonlinearly, and I've only validated up to 21x21. The tuning constants introduced by this change are:

tuning table, yajog-yahof:
BUDGETS = {
    "lamvan": 303,
    "wenox": 460,
    "fenvan": 525,
}

Changed defaults in Splitfork, our assignment service. Bucketing now uses sticky hashing per account instead of per session, and the holdout slice grew from 2% to 5%. Callers relying on session-level reassignment must opt in explicitly. Review the diff against the new baseline; the updated default configuration is listed below.

config for tagep-kajof:
[casir]
port = 6379
region = south-1
host = casir.paliqdyn.example
team = tamax
timeout_ms = 250
retries = 2